Retinal regeneration has been mostly studied after widespread tissue injury, but it is not well understood how the retina regenerates at the cellular level following loss of specific cell types. In a new study, Jeff Mumm and colleagues selectively ablate retinal ganglion cells in zebrafish and find that the retina elicits different genetic responses in a context-dependent manner to replace lost cells. To find out more about the story behind the paper, we caught up with first author Kevin Emmerich and corresponding author Jeff Mumm, Associate Professor in Ophthalmology at Johns Hopkins University.

Minimally invasive liquid biopsies from the eye capture locally enriched fluids that contain thousands of proteins from highly specialized ocular cell types, presenting a promising alternative to solid tissue biopsies. The advantages of liquid biopsies include sampling the eye without causing irreversible functional damage, potentially better reflecting tissue heterogeneity, collecting samples in an outpatient setting, monitoring therapeutic response with sequential sampling, and even allowing examination of disease mechanisms at the cell level in living humans, an approach that we refer to as TEMPO (Tracing Expression of Multiple Protein Origins). Liquid biopsy proteomics has the potential to transform molecular diagnostics and prognostics and to assess disease mechanisms and personalized therapeutic strategies in individual patients. This review addresses opportunities, challenges, and future directions of high-resolution liquid biopsy proteomics in ophthalmology, with particular emphasis on the large-scale collection of high-quality samples, cutting edge proteomics technology, and artificial intelligence-supported data analysis.

TOPIC: This systematic review examined geographical and temporal trends in medical school ophthalmology education in relationship to course and student outcomes. CLINICAL RELEVANCE: Evidence suggesting a decline in ophthalmology teaching in medical schools is increasing, raising concern for the adequacy of eye knowledge across the rest of the medical profession. METHODS: Systematic review of Embase and SCOPUS, with inclusion of studies containing data on medical school ophthalmic course length; 1 or more outcome measures on student ophthalmology knowledge, skills, self-evaluation of knowledge or skills, or student course appraisal; or both. The systematic review was registered prospectively on the International Prospective Register of Systematic Reviews (identifier, CRD42022323865). Results were aggregated with outcome subgroup analysis and description in relationship to geographical and temporal trends. Descriptive statistics, including nonparametric correlations, were used to analyze data and trends. RESULTS: Systematic review yielded 4596 publication titles, of which 52 were included in the analysis, with data from 19 countries. Average course length ranged from 12.5 to 208.7 hours, with significant continental disparity among mean course lengths. Africa reported the longest average course length at 103.3 hours, and North America reported the shortest at 36.4 hours. On average, course lengths have been declining over the last 2 decades, from an average overall course length of 92.9 hours in the 2000s to 52.9 hours in the 2020s. Mean student self-evaluation of skills was 51.3%, and mean student self-evaluation of knowledge was 55.4%. Objective mean assessment mark of skills was 57.5% and that of knowledge was 71.7%, compared with an average pass mark of 66.7%. On average, 26.4% of students felt confident in their ophthalmology knowledge and 34.5% felt confident in their skills. DISCUSSION: Most evidence describes declining length of courses devoted to ophthalmology in the last 20 years, significant student dissatisfaction with courses and content, and suboptimal knowledge and confidence. PURPOSE: To compare population demographics with the geographic distribution of oculofacial plastic surgeons (OPSs) in the United States. DESIGN: A cross-sectional study design was used to investigate demographic differences between counties with 1 or more OPSs and counties with zero OPSs. PARTICIPANTS: The number of OPSs were identified in each US county using online public databases: American Society of Ophthalmic Plastic and Reconstructive Surgeons and American Academy of Ophthalmology. Counties were categorized into 2 groups: 1 or more OPSs and zero OPSs. Demographic characteristics at the county level were obtained from the 2021 US Census Bureau Population Estimates and the American Community Survey. Cost of living was collected from the 2022 Economic Policy Institute Family Budget Calculator. MAIN OUTCOME MEASURES: Socioeconomic demographics of the US population as related to geographic OPS distribution. RESULTS: A total of 1238 OPSs were identified. States with the most OPSs per million were Hawaii (6.2), D.C. (6.0), Connecticut (5.8), Utah (5.1), and Maryland (5.0). Among 3143 counties, 2725 (86.7%) had zero OPSs and 418 (13.3%) had 1 or more OPSs. Counties with 1 or more OPSs had a higher median (standard deviation) household income versus counties with zero OPSs ($72 471 [$19 152] vs. $56 152 [$13 675]; difference $16 319; 95% confidence interval [CI], $14 300-$18 338; P < 0.001). The annual cost of living per person (standard deviation) was higher in counties with 1 or more OPSs versus counties with zero OPSs ($39 238 [$6992] vs. $36 227 [$3516]; difference $3011; 95% CI, $2328-$3694; P < 0.001). Counties with zero OPSs versus counties with 1 or more OPSs had higher proportions of persons with only Medicaid (15.6% vs. 13.6%; difference 2.0%; 95% CI, 1.4%-2.5%; P < 0.001), no health insurance (9.9% vs. 8.0%; difference 1.9%; 95% CI, 1.5%-2.4%; P < 0.001), no household internet access (17.2% vs. 9.6%; difference 7.6%; 95% CI, 7.1%-8.0%; P < 0.001), and higher proportions of persons aged 65 years or older (20.0% vs. 17.0%; difference 3.0%; 95% CI, 2.5%-3.5%; P < 0.001). CONCLUSIONS: This cross-sectional analysis of all US counties revealed socioeconomic disparities associated with access to OPSs. PURPOSE: Private equity (PE) firms increasingly are acquiring ophthalmology practices; little is known of their influence on care use and spending. We studied changes in use and Medicare spending after PE acquisition. DESIGN: Retrospective cohort study. PARTICIPANTS: Seven hundred sixty-two clinicians in 123 practices acquired by PE between 2017 and 2018 and 34 807 clinicians in 20 549 never-acquired practices. METHODS: We analyzed Medicare fee-for-service claims (2012-2019) combined with a novel national database of PE acquisitions of ophthalmology practices using a difference-in-differences method within an event study framework to compare changes after a practice was acquired with changes in practices that were not acquired. MAIN OUTCOME MEASURES: Numbers of beneficiaries seen; intravitreal injections and medications used for injections; and spending on ophthalmologist and optometrist services, ancillary services, and intravitreal injections. RESULTS: Comparing PE-acquired with nonacquired practices showed a 23.92% increase (n = 4.20 beneficiaries; 95% confidence interval [CI], 1.73-6.67) in beneficiaries seen per PE optometrist per quarter and no change for ophthalmologists, while spending per beneficiary increased 5.06% ($9.66; 95% CI, -2.82 to 22.14). Spending on clinician services decreased 1.62% (-$2.37; 95% CI, -5.78 to 1.04), with ophthalmologist services increasing 5.46% ($17.70; 95% CI, -2.73 to 38.15) and optometrists decreasing 4.60% (-$5.76; 95% CI, -9.17 to -2.34) per beneficiary per quarter. Ancillary services decreased 7.56% (-$2.19; 95% CI, 4.19 to -0.22). Intravitreal injection costs increased 25.0% ($20.02; 95% CI, -1.38 to 41.41) with the number increasing 5.10% (1.83; 95% CI, -0.1 to 3.80). There was a 74.09% increase (8.38 injections; 95% CI, 0.01-16.74) in ranibizumab and a 12.91% decrease (-3.40 injections; 95% CI, -6.86 to 0.07) in bevacizumab after acquisition. The event study showed consistent and often statistically significant increases in ranibizumab injections and decreases in bevacizumab injections after acquisition. CONCLUSIONS: Although not all results reached statistical significance, this study suggested that PE acquisition of practices showed little or no overall effect on use or total spending, but increased the number of unique patients seen per optometrist and the use of expensive intravitreal injections. PURPOSE: To analyze ophthalmology workforce supply and demand projections from 2020 to 2035. DESIGN: Observational cohort study using data from the National Center for Health Workforce Analysis (NCHWA). METHODS: Data accessed from the Department of Health and Human Services, Health Resources and Services Administration (HRSA) website were compiled to analyze the workforce supply and demand projections for ophthalmologists from 2020 to 2035. MAIN OUTCOME MEASURES: Projected workforce adequacy over time. RESULTS: From 2020 to 2035, the total ophthalmology supply is projected to decrease by 2650 full-time equivalent (FTE) ophthalmologists (12% decline) and total demand is projected to increase by 5150 FTE ophthalmologists (24% increase), representing a supply and demand mismatch of 30% workforce inadequacy. The level of projected adequacy was markedly different based on rurality by year 2035 with 77% workforce adequacy versus 29% workforce adequacy in metro and nonmetro geographies, respectively. By year 2035, ophthalmology is projected to have the second worst rate of workforce adequacy (70%) of 38 medical and surgical specialties studied. CONCLUSIONS: The HRSA's Health Workforce Simulation Model forecasts a sizeable shortage of ophthalmology supply relative to demand by the year 2035, with substantial geographic disparities. Ophthalmology is one of the medical specialties with the lowest rate of projected workforce adequacy by 2035. Further dedicated workforce supply and demand research for ophthalmology and allied professionals is needed to validate these projections, which may have significant future implications for patients and providers. PURPOSE: To assess the demographic characteristics and geographic distribution of neuro-ophthalmologists practicing in the United States. DESIGN: A cross-sectional study. PARTICIPANTS: Neuro-ophthalmologists across the United States. METHODS: In this cross-sectional study, public databases from the American Academy of Ophthalmology, North American Neuro-ophthalmology Society, American Neurological Association, and American Academy of Neurology were used to identify neuro-ophthalmologists in the United States as of April 2023. Providers' office locations were geocoded using ArcGIS pro, version 2.9 (Esri). Data on age, sex, and residency and fellowship training were collected. Analysis was performed using SPSS 28.0 (IBM Corp.). MAIN OUTCOME MEASURES: Neuro-ophthalmologists' demographics, and information about their medical education, postgraduate education, residency training, fellowship training, years in practice, practice environment, and geographic distribution of neuro-ophthalmologists across the United States. RESULTS: A total of 635 neuro-ophthalmologists (436 male, 68.7%) were identified. The majority (599, 94.3%) graduated from an allopathic medical school. Most of the 85 physicians who held a secondary graduate degree had a PhD (54, 63.5%). Although approximately three-quarters (429, 67.6%) completed their residency in ophthalmology, 159 (25%) had residency positions in neurology and 47 (7.4%) had residency positions in both. Approximately one-third (191, 30.0%) were trained in more than 1 fellowship, including oculoplastics (78, 12.3%) or pediatric ophthalmology (53, 8.3%). The average post-fellowship years of experience was 23.7±13.7 years, with 134 (21.1%) in their early career (< 10 years), 120 (18.9%) in their mid-careers (10-19 years), and 381 (60.0%) in their late careers (> 20 years). Male neuro-ophthalmologists had 10.5±1.1 more years of experience than female neuro-ophthalmologists (P < 0.001). Three states (Maine, South Dakota, Wyoming) and 2897 counties (93.2%) had no neuro-ophthalmologists. Counties without a neuro-ophthalmologist had lower median income (P < 0.001), lower access to a vehicle (P = 0.024), and lower rates of health insurance (P = 0.012). CONCLUSIONS: Practicing neuro-ophthalmologists are mostly male and often are trained in more than 1 subspecialty. More than half of the practicing neuro-ophthalmologists are in their late careers, which may further exacerbate the existing geographic and socioeconomic disparities in access to neuro-ophthalmology. PURPOSE: To review the published literature evaluating the visual and refractive outcomes and rotational stability of eyes implanted with toric monofocal intraocular lenses (IOLs) for the correction of keratometric astigmatism during cataract surgery and to compare those outcomes with outcomes of eyes implanted with nontoric monofocal IOLs and other astigmatism management methods performed during cataract surgery. This assessment was restricted to the toric IOLs available in the United States. METHODS: A literature search of English-language publications in the PubMed database was last conducted in July 2022. The search identified 906 potentially relevant citations, and after review of the abstracts, 63 were selected for full-text review. Twenty-one studies ultimately were determined to be relevant to the assessment criteria and were selected for inclusion. The panel methodologist assigned each a level of evidence rating; 12 studies were rated level I and 9 studies were rated level II. RESULTS: Eyes implanted with toric IOLs showed excellent postoperative uncorrected distance visual acuity (UCDVA), reduction of postoperative refractive astigmatism, and good rotational stability. Uncorrected distance visual acuity was better and postoperative cylinder was lower with toric IOLs, regardless of manufacturer, when compared with nontoric monofocal IOLs. Correcting pre-existing astigmatism with toric IOLs was more effective and predictable than using corneal relaxing incisions (CRIs), especially in the presence of higher magnitudes of astigmatism. CONCLUSIONS: Toric monofocal IOLs are effective in neutralizing pre-existing corneal astigmatism at the time of cataract surgery and result in better UCDVA and significant reductions in postoperative refractive astigmatism compared with nontoric monofocal IOLs. Toric IOLs result in better astigmatic correction than CRIs, particularly at high magnitudes of astigmatism. PURPOSE: To assess changes in vision care availability at Federally Qualified Health Centers (FQHCs) between 2017 and 2021 and whether neighborhood-level demographic social risk factors (SRFs) associated with eye care services provided by FQHCs. DESIGN: Secondary data analysis of the Health Resources and Services Administration (HRSA) data and 2017-2021 American Community Survey (ACS). PARTICIPANTS: Federally Qualified Health Centers. METHODS: Patient and neighborhood characteristics for SRFs were summarized. Differences in FQHCs providing and not providing vision care were compared via Wilcoxon-Mann-Whitney tests for continuous measures and chi-square tests for categorical measures. Logistic regression models were used to test the associations between neighborhood measures and FQHCs providing vision care, adjusted for patient characteristics. MAIN OUTCOME MEASURES: Odds ratios (ORs) with 95% confidence intervals (CIs) for neighborhood-level predictors of FQHCs providing vision care services. RESULTS: Overall, 28.5% of FQHCs (n = 375/1318) provided vision care in 2017 versus 32% (n = 435/1362) in 2021 with some increases and decreases in both the number of FQHCs and those with and without vision services. Only 2.6% of people who accessed FQHC services received eye care in 2021. Among the 435 FQHCs that provided vision care in 2021, 27.1% (n = 118) had added vision services between 2017 and 2021, 71.5% (n = 311) had been offering vision services since at least 2017, and 1.4% (n = 6) were newly established. FQHCs providing vision care in 2021 were more likely to be in neighborhoods with a higher percentage of Hispanic/Latino individuals (OR, 1.08, 95% CI, 1.02-1.14, P = 0.0094), Medicaid-insured individuals (OR, 1.08, 95% CI, 1.02-1.14, P = 0.0120), and no car households (OR, 1.07, 95% CI, 1.01-1.13, P = 0.0142). However, FQHCs with vision care, compared to FQHCs without vision care, served a lower percentage of Hispanic/Latino individuals (27.2% vs. 33.9%, P = 0.0007), Medicaid-insured patients (42.8% vs. 46.8%, P < 0.0001), and patients living at or below 100% of the federal poverty line (61.3% vs. 66.3%, P < 0.0001). CONCLUSIONS: Vision care services are available at a few FQHCs, localized to a few states. Expanding eye care access at FQHCs would meet patients where they seek care to mitigate vision loss to underserved communities. PURPOSE: To determine the intraocular pressure (IOP) reduction of various trabecular procedures (a form of minimally invasive glaucoma surgery [MIGS]) combined with cataract surgery compared with cataract surgery alone, to compare the safety of the various trabecular procedures, and to highlight patient characteristics that may favor one trabecular procedure over another. METHODS: A search of English-language peer-reviewed literature in the PubMed database was initially conducted in February 2021 and updated in April 2023. This yielded 279 articles. Twenty studies met initial inclusion and exclusion criteria and were assessed for quality by the panel methodologist. Of these, 10 were rated level I, 3 were rated level II, and 7 were rated level III. Only the 10 level I randomized controlled trials (RCTs) were included in this assessment, and all were subject to potential industry-sponsorship bias. RESULTS: The current analysis focuses on the amount of IOP reduction (in studies that involved medication washout) and on IOP reduction with concurrent medication reduction (in studies that did not involve medication washout). Based on studies that performed a medication washout, adding a trabecular procedure to cataract surgery provided an additional 1.6 to 2.3 mmHg IOP reduction in subjects with hypertensive, mild to moderate open-angle glaucoma (OAG) at 2 years over cataract surgery alone, which itself provided approximately 5.4 to 7.6 mmHg IOP reduction. In other words, adding a trabecular procedure provided an additional 3.8% to 8.9% IOP reduction over cataract surgery alone, which itself provided 21% to 28% IOP reduction. There was no clear benefit of one trabecular procedure over another. Patient-specific considerations that can guide procedure selection include uveitis predisposition, bleeding risk, metal allergy, and narrowing of Schlemm's canal. There are no level I data on the efficacy of trabecular procedures in subjects with pretreatment IOP of 21 mmHg or less. CONCLUSIONS: Trabecular procedures combined with cataract surgery provide an additional mild IOP reduction over cataract surgery alone in hypertensive OAG subjects. Additional research should standardize outcome definitions, avoid industry sponsorship bias, and study the efficacy of these procedures in normotensive OAG. PURPOSE: To evaluate the current published literature on the utility of the 10-2 visual field (VF) testing strategy for the evaluation and management of early glaucoma, defined here as mean deviation (MD) better than -6 decibels (dB). METHODS: A search of the peer-reviewed literature was last conducted in June 2023 in the PubMed database. Abstracts of 986 articles were examined to exclude reviews and non-English-language articles. After inclusion and exclusion criteria were applied, 26 articles were selected, and the panel methodologist rated them for strength of evidence. Thirteen articles were rated level I, and 8 articles were rated level II. The 5 level III articles were excluded. Data from the 21 included articles were abstracted and reviewed. RESULTS: The central 12 locations on the 24-2 VF test grid lie within the central 10 degrees covered by the 10-2 VF test. In early glaucoma, defects detected within the central 10 degrees generally agree between the 2 tests. Defects within the central 10 degrees of the 24-2 VF test can predict defects on the 10-2 VF test, although the 24-2 may miss defects detected on the 10-2 VF test. In addition, results from the 10-2 VF test show better association with findings from OCT scans of the macular ganglion cell complex. Modifications of the 24-2 test that include extra test locations within the central 10 degrees improve detection of central defects found on 10-2 VF testing. CONCLUSIONS: Evidence to date does not support routine testing using 10-2 VF for patients with early glaucoma. However, early 10-2 VF testing may provide sufficient additional information for some patients, particularly those with a repeatable defect within the central 12 locations of the standard 24-2 VF test or who have inner retinal layer thinning on OCT scans of the macula. PURPOSE: To evaluate the recently published literature on the efficacy and safety of the use of aqueous shunts with extraocular reservoir for the management of adult open-angle glaucomas (OAGs). METHODS: A search of peer-reviewed literature was last conducted in April 2023 of the PubMed database and included only articles published since the last aqueous shunt Ophthalmic Technology Assessment, which assessed articles published before 2008. The abstracts of these 419 articles were examined, and 58 studies were selected for full-text analysis. After inclusion and exclusion criteria were applied, 28 articles were selected and assigned ratings by the panel methodologist according to the level of evidence. Twenty-five articles were rated level I and 3 articles were rated level II. There were no level III articles. RESULTS: Implantation of aqueous shunts with extraocular reservoir can lower intraocular pressure (IOP) by between one-third and one-half of baseline IOP, depending on whether it is undertaken as the primary or secondary glaucoma surgery. Success rates for aqueous shunts were found to be better than for trabeculectomies in eyes with prior incisional surgery. Conversely, in eyes without prior incisional surgery, implantation of aqueous shunts was found to have an overall lower success rate as the primary glaucoma procedure compared with trabeculectomy. Although both valved and nonvalved aqueous shunts with extraocular reservoir were effective, the nonvalved device generally achieved slightly lower long-term IOPs with fewer glaucoma medications and less need for additional glaucoma surgery. Both devices slow the rates of visual field progression with efficacy comparable with that of trabeculectomy. Early aqueous humor suppression after aqueous shunt implantation is recommended for the management of the postoperative hypertensive phase and long-term IOP control. No strong evidence supports the routine use of mitomycin C with aqueous shunt implantation for OAG. CONCLUSIONS: Implantation of aqueous shunts with extraocular reservoir, including valved or nonvalved devices, has been shown to be an effective strategy to lower IOP. Strong level I evidence supports the use of aqueous shunts with extraocular reservoir by clinicians for the management of adult OAG. PURPOSE: To review the published literature on the diagnostic capabilities of the newest generation of corneal imaging devices for the identification of keratoconus. METHODS: Corneal imaging devices studied included tomographic platforms (Scheimpflug photography, OCT) and functional biomechanical devices (imaging an air impulse on the cornea). A literature search in the PubMed database for English language studies was last conducted in February 2023. The search yielded 469 citations, which were reviewed in abstract form. Of these, 147 were relevant to the assessment objectives and underwent full-text review. Forty-five articles met the criteria for inclusion and were assigned a level of evidence rating by the panel methodologist. Twenty-six articles were rated level II, and 19 articles were rated level III. There were no level I evidence studies of corneal imaging for the diagnosis of keratoconus found in the literature. To provide a common cross-study outcome measure, diagnostic sensitivity, specificity, and area under the receiver operating characteristic curve (AUC) were extracted. (A perfect diagnostic test that identifies all cases properly has an AUC of 1.0.) RESULTS: For the detection of keratoconus, sensitivities for all devices and parameters (e.g., anterior or posterior corneal curvature, corneal thickness) ranged from 65% to 100%. The majority of studies and parameters had sensitivities greater than 90%. The AUCs ranged from 0.82 to 1.00, with the majority greater than 0.90. Combined indices that integrated multiple parameters had an AUC in the mid-0.90 range. Keratoconus suspect detection performance was lower with AUCs ranging from 0.66 to 0.99, but most devices and parameters had sensitivities less than 90%. CONCLUSIONS: Modern corneal imaging devices provide improved characterization of the cornea and are accurate in detecting keratoconus with high AUCs ranging from 0.82 to 1.00. The detection of keratoconus suspects is less accurate with AUCs ranging from 0.66 to 0.99. Parameters based on single anatomic locations had a wide range of AUCs. Studies with combined indices using more data and parameters consistently reported high AUCs. PURPOSE: To review the current published literature for high-quality studies on the use of selective laser trabeculoplasty (SLT) for the treatment of glaucoma. This is an update of the Ophthalmic Technology Assessment titled, "Laser Trabeculoplasty for Open-Angle Glaucoma," published in November 2011. METHODS: Literature searches in the PubMed database in March 2020, September 2021, August 2022, and March 2023 yielded 110 articles. The abstracts of these articles were examined to include those written since November 2011 and to exclude reviews and non-English articles. The panel reviewed 47 articles in full text, and 30 were found to fit the inclusion criteria. The panel methodologist assigned a level I rating to 19 studies and a level II rating to 11 studies. RESULTS: Data in the level I studies support the long-term effectiveness of SLT as primary treatment or as a supplemental therapy to glaucoma medications for patients with open-angle glaucoma. Several level I studies also found that SLT and argon laser trabeculoplasty (ALT) are equivalent in terms of safety and long-term efficacy. Level I evidence indicates that perioperative corticosteroid and nonsteroidal anti-inflammatory drug eye drops do not hinder the intraocular pressure (IOP)-lowering effect of SLT treatment. The impact of these eye drops on lowering IOP differed in various studies. No level I or II studies exist that determine the ideal power settings for SLT. CONCLUSIONS: Based on level I evidence, SLT is an effective long-term option for the treatment of open-angle glaucoma and is equivalent to ALT. It can be used as either a primary intervention, a replacement for medication, or an additional therapy with glaucoma medications. PURPOSE: Investigate trends in keratoconus (KCN) treatment patterns and diagnosis age from 2015 to 2020 and evaluate sociodemographic associations with the treatment approach. DESIGN: Retrospective cohort study. PARTICIPANTS: Patients with a new KCN diagnosis from 2015 to 2020 were identified in the Academy IRIS® Registry (Intelligent Research in Sight). METHODS: Associations between sociodemographic factors and treatment were evaluated using multivariable logistic regression. MAIN OUTCOME MEASURES: Outcomes included percentages and rates of each treatment (collagen crosslinking [CXL], keratoplasty, or no procedure) from 2015 to 2020, age at diagnosis during this period, and sociodemographic factors associated with treatment type. RESULTS: A total of 66 199 patients with a new diagnosis of KCN were identified. The percentage of patients undergoing CXL increased from 0.05% in 2015 to 29.5% in 2020 (P = 0.008). The average age (standard deviation) of KCN patients decreased from 44.1 (±16.9) years in 2015 to 39.2 (±16.9) years in 2020 (P < 0.001). In multivariable analyses comparing CXL versus no procedure and keratoplasty versus no procedure, patients undergoing CXL tended to be younger with the odds of having CXL decreasing with increasing age, for example, comparing CXL and no procedure patients, using ages 0-20 years as reference, the odds ratio (OR) (95% confidence interval [CI]) decreased from 0.62 (0.57-0.67; P < 0.0001) for patients aged 21-40 years to 0.03 (0.02-0.04; P < 0.0001) for patients aged > 60 years. Men were more likely than women to have CXL (OR, 1.31; 95% CI, 1.23-1.40; P < 0.0001) and keratoplasty (OR, 1.30; 95% CI, 1.19-1.42; P < 0.0001). Black patients were less likely than White patients to have CXL (OR, 0.70; 95% CI, 0.63-0.77; P < 0.0001) and more likely to have keratoplasty (OR, 2.24; 95% CI, 2.01-2.50; P < 0.0001). Likewise, Hispanic patients had higher odds of CXL (OR, 1.12; 95% CI, 1.00-1.24; P < 0.05) and keratoplasty (OR, 1.29; 95% CI, 1.12-1.50; P < 0.001) compared with non-Hispanic patients. Collagen crosslinking and keratoplasty also varied by region and insurance status. CONCLUSIONS: A significant increase in use of CXL was noted from 2015 to 2020. Sociodemographic differences in treatment among KCN patients may reflect differences in access, use, or care patterns, and future studies should aim to identify strategies to improve access for all patients. PURPOSE: To review the published literature on the safety and outcomes of keratolimbal allograft (KLAL) transplantation and living-related conjunctival limbal allograft (lr-CLAL) transplantation for bilateral severe/total limbal stem cell deficiency (LSCD). METHODS: Literature searches were last conducted in the PubMed database in February 2023 and were limited to the English language. They yielded 523 citations; 76 were reviewed in full text, and 21 met the inclusion criteria. Two studies were rated level II, and the remaining 19 studies were rated level III. There were no level I studies. RESULTS: After KLAL surgery, best-corrected visual acuity (BCVA) improved in 42% to 92% of eyes at final follow-up (range, 12-95 months). The BCVA was unchanged in 17% to 39% of eyes and decreased in 8% to 29% of eyes. Two of 14 studies that evaluated the results of KLAL reported a notable decline in visual acuity over time postoperatively. Survival of KLAL was variable, ranging from 21% to 90% at last follow-up (range, 12-95 months) and decreased over time. For patients undergoing lr-CLAL surgery, BCVA improved in 31% to 100% of eyes at final follow-up (range, 16-49 months). Of the 9 studies evaluating lr-CLAL, 4 reported BCVA unchanged in 30% to 39% of patients, and 3 reported a decline in BCVA in 8% to 10% of patients. The survival rate of lr-CLAL ranged from 50% to 100% at final follow-up (range, 16-49 months). The most common complications were postoperative elevation of intraocular pressure, persistent epithelial defects, and acute allograft immune rejections. CONCLUSIONS: Given limited options for patients with bilateral LSCD, both KLAL and lr-CLAL are viable choices that may provide improvement of vision and ocular surface findings. The studies trend toward a lower rejection rate and graft failure with lr-CLAL. However, the level and duration of immunosuppression vary widely between the studies and may impact allograft rejections and long-term graft survival. Complications related to immunosuppression are minimal. Repeat surgery may be needed to maintain a viable ocular surface. Reasonable long-term success can be achieved with both KLAL and lr-CLAL with appropriate systemic immunosuppression. PURPOSE: This American Academy of Ophthalmology Ophthalmic Technology Assessment aims to assess the effectiveness of conventional teleretinal screening (TS) in detecting diabetic retinopathy (DR) and diabetic macular edema (DME). METHODS: A literature search of the PubMed database was conducted most recently in July 2023 to identify data published between 2006 and 2023 on any of the following elements related to TS effectiveness: (1) the accuracy of TS in detecting DR or DME compared with traditional ophthalmic screening with dilated fundus examination or 7-standard field Early Treatment Diabetic Retinopathy Study photography, (2) the impact of TS on DR screening compliance rates or other patient behaviors, and (3) cost-effectiveness and patient satisfaction of TS compared with traditional DR screening. Identified studies then were rated based on the Oxford Centre for Evidence-Based Medicine grading system. RESULTS: Eight level I studies, 14 level II studies, and 2 level III studies were identified in total. Although cross-study comparison is challenging because of differences in reference standards and grading methods, TS demonstrated acceptable sensitivity and good specificity in detecting DR; moderate to good agreement between TS and reference-standard DR grading was observed. Performance of TS was not as robust in detecting DME, although the number of studies evaluating DME specifically was limited. Two level I studies, 5 level II studies, and 1 level III study supported that TS had a positive impact on overall DR screening compliance, even increasing it by more than 2-fold in one study. Studies assessing cost-effectiveness and patient satisfaction were not graded formally, but they generally showed that TS was cost-effective and preferred by patients over traditional surveillance. CONCLUSIONS: Conventional TS is an effective approach to DR screening not only for its accuracy in detecting referable-level disease, but also for improving screening compliance in a cost-effective manner that may be preferred by patients. Further research is needed to elucidate the ideal approach of TS that may involve integration of artificial intelligence or other imaging technologies in the future. PURPOSE: To review the evidence on the effectiveness and complications of periocular and intraocular corticosteroid therapies for noninfectious uveitic macular edema. METHODS: A literature search of the PubMed database was conducted last in December 2021 and a post-assessment search was conducted in March 2023. The searches were limited to articles published in English and no date restrictions were imposed. The combined searches yielded 739 citations; 53 articles were selected for inclusion because the studies (1) evaluated periocular corticosteroid injection, intraocular corticosteroid injection or implant, suprachoroidal corticosteroid injection, or a combination thereof for uveitic macular edema; (2) had outcomes that included visual acuity (VA) or macular edema assessed clinically or imaged by OCT or fluorescein angiography; and (3) included more than 20 patients. RESULTS: This assessment reviewed 23 articles that provided level I or level II evidence from 18 studies on the use of periocular, suprachoroidal, and intravitreal triamcinolone acetonide injections and intravitreal dexamethasone and fluocinolone acetonide implants or inserts in noninfectious uveitic macular edema. These reports consistently demonstrated that all investigated periocular and intraocular corticosteroid therapies improved VA, macular structure, or both. One comparative study showed that intravitreal triamcinolone acetonide injection and the dexamethasone intravitreal implant had effectiveness superior to that of periocular triamcinolone acetonide injection for these outcomes. As a group, the studies highlighted the potential for these therapies to elevate intraocular pressure and to accelerate cataract formation. CONCLUSIONS: The published literature provides high-quality evidence that periocular and intraocular corticosteroid therapies are effective and safe for the treatment of noninfectious uveitic macular edema. However, information on the relative effectiveness and complication rates across the different therapies is limited. PURPOSE: To review the evidence on the safety and effectiveness of epithelium-off corneal collagen cross-linking (CXL) for the treatment of progressive corneal ectasia. METHODS: A literature search of the PubMed database was most recently conducted in March 2024 with no date restrictions and limited to studies published in English. The search identified 359 citations that were reviewed in abstract form, and 43 of these were reviewed in full text. High-quality randomized clinical trials comparing epithelium-off CXL with conservative treatment in patients who have keratoconus (KCN) and post-refractive surgery ectasia were included. The panel deemed 6 articles to be of sufficient relevance for inclusion, and these were assessed for quality by the panel methodologist; 5 were rated level I, and 1 was rated level II. There were no level III studies. RESULTS: This analysis includes 6 prospective, randomized controlled trials that evaluated the use of epithelium-off CXL to treat progressive KCN (5 studies) and post-laser refractive surgery ectasia (1 study), with a mean postoperative follow-up of 2.4 years (range, 1-5 years). All studies showed a decreased progression rate in treated patients compared with controls. Improvement in the maximum keratometry (Kmax) value, corrected distance visual acuity (CDVA), and uncorrected distance visual acuity (UDVA) was observed in the treatment groups compared with control groups. A decrease in corneal thickness was observed in both groups but was greater in the CXL group. Complications were rare. CONCLUSIONS: Epithelium-off CXL is effective in reducing the progression of KCN and post-laser refractive surgery ectasia in most treated patients with an acceptable safety profile. This review presents current knowledge on the molecular biology of retinoblastoma (RB). Retinoblastoma is an intraocular tumor with hereditary and sporadic forms. 8,000 new cases of this ocular malignancy of the developing retina are diagnosed each year worldwide. The major gene responsible for retinoblastoma is RB1, and it harbors a large spectrum of pathogenic variants. Tumorigenesis begins with mutations that cause RB1 biallelic inactivation preventing the production of functional pRB proteins. Depending on the type of mutation the penetrance of RB is different. However, in small percent of tumors additional genes may be required, such as MYCN, BCOR and CREBBP. Additionally, epigenetic changes contribute to the progression of retinoblastoma as well. Besides its role in the cell cycle, pRB plays many additional roles, it regulates the nucleosome structure, participates in apoptosis, DNA replication, cellular senescence, differentiation, DNA repair and angiogenesis. Notably, pRB has an important role as a modulator of chromatin remodeling. In recent years high-throughput techniques are becoming essential for credible biomarker identification and patient management improvement. In spite of remarkable advances in retinoblastoma therapy, primarily in high-income countries, our understanding of retinoblastoma and its specific genetics still needs further clarification in order to predict the course of this disease and improve therapy. One such approach is the tumor free DNA that can be obtained from the anterior segment of the eye and be useful in diagnostics and prognostics.
